-
當前位置:首頁 > 創(chuàng)意學院 > 營銷推廣 > 專題列表 > 正文
IIS下直接301設置
Internet信息服務管理器 -> 虛擬目錄 -> 重定向到URL,輸入需要轉向的目標URL,并選擇“資源的永久重定向”。
這個需要服務器直接操作,很多空間商不會給做。
介于空間管理程序和方法各不相同,例如之后的WEB操作管理 有可能導致301間接失效所以如果不是自己獨立服務器 不建議直接操作。條條大路通羅馬看下:
采用isapi-rewirte組件 的偽靜態(tài)完全獨立,可以直接在原偽靜態(tài)規(guī)則文件httpd.ini 加上301跳轉代碼 立即生效【詳解:利用 ISAPI Rewrite 做301永久重定向】
[ISAPI_Rewrite]
CacheClockRate 3600
RepeatLimit 32
RewriteEngine On
RewriteCond Host: ^boaer.com$
RewriteRule (.*) http://www.boaer.com$1 [I,RP]
注:----URL標準化的301重定向(以上代碼)需要寫在其他URL-rewrite代碼之前。
[ISAPI_Rewrite]
CacheClockRate 3600
RepeatLimit 32
RewriteEngine On
RewriteCond Host: ^boaer.com$
RewriteRule (.*) http://www.boaer.com$1 [I,RP]
注:----URL標準化的301重定向(以上代碼)需要寫在其他URL-rewrite代碼之前。
老域名失效自動跳轉(老域名失效自動跳轉怎么回事)
大家好!今天讓創(chuàng)意嶺的小編來大家介紹下關于老域名失效自動跳轉的問題,以下是小編對此問題的歸納整理,讓我們一起來看看吧。
ChatGPT國內免費在線使用,一鍵生成原創(chuàng)文章、方案、文案、工作計劃、工作報告、論文、代碼、作文、做題和對話答疑等等
只需要輸入關鍵詞,就能返回你想要的內容,越精準,寫出的就越詳細,有微信小程序端、在線網(wǎng)頁版、PC客戶端
官網(wǎng):https://ai.de1919.com
本文目錄:
一、如何設置域名跳轉?
IIS站點中有時需要限制某些域名訪問,需要訪問一個域名跳轉到另一個域名,具體方法為:
1、首先打開Dreamweaver軟件,并打開一個index.htm或者index.html文件。
2、寫入代碼:(注:把將這里改成要跳轉的域名改為你想跳轉的域名,例如:www.baidu.com)
<script language="javascript" type="text/javascript">
window.location="http://將這里改成要跳轉的域名";;</script>
3、寫好之后Ctrl+S保存并測試跳轉是否成功。
4、成功之后如圖所示,跳轉的是該頁面。
5、打開第二個軟件FlashFXP。
6、上傳index.htm或者index.html替換掉原有的index.htm或者index.html,則成功跳轉。
注意事項:
IIS是企業(yè)的CI特征通過互聯(lián)網(wǎng)演繹向公眾主動的展示與傳播,是企業(yè)識別體系重要的有機組成部分,是企業(yè)CI特征互聯(lián)網(wǎng)化的產物。
二、怎么打開一個域名后自動轉到另一個網(wǎng)站
打開域名A自動跳轉到域名B,可以采用網(wǎng)站301跳轉的方式:
2、ASP下的301轉向代碼
<%@ Language=VBScript %>
<%
Response.Status=”301 Moved Permanently”
Response.AddHeader “Location”, “http://www.*****/***/301/”
%>
3、轉向代碼
<script runat=”server”>
private void Page_Load(object sender, System.EventArgs e)
{
Response.Status = “301 Moved Permanently”;
Response.AddHeader(”Location”,”http://www.*****.cn/***/301/“);
}
</script>
4、PHP下的301轉向代碼
header(”HTTP/1.1 301 Moved Permanently”);
header(”Location: http://www.*****.cn/***/301/”);
exit();
5、CGI Perl下的301轉向代碼
$q = new CGI;
print $q->redirect(”http://www.*****.com/”);
6、轉向代碼
<%
response.setStatus(301);
response.setHeader( “Location”, “http://www.*****.cn/” );
response.setHeader( “Connection”, “close” );
%>
7、轉向代碼
新建.htaccess文件,輸入下列內容(需要開啟mod_rewrite):
1)將不帶WWW的域名轉向到帶WWW的域名下
Options +FollowSymLinks
RewriteEngine on
RewriteCond %{HTTP_HOST} ^boaer.cn [NC]
RewriteRule ^(.*)$ http://www.*****.cn/$1 [L,R=301]
2)重定向到新域名
Options +FollowSymLinks
RewriteEngine on
RewriteRule ^(.*)$ http://www.*****.cn/$1 [L,R=301]
3)使用正則進行301轉向,實現(xiàn)偽靜態(tài)
Options +FollowSymLinks
RewriteEngine on
RewriteRule ^news-(.+).html$ news.php?id=$1
將news.php?id=123這樣的地址轉向到news-123.html
8、Apache下vhosts.conf中配置301轉向
為實現(xiàn)URL規(guī)范化,SEO通常將不帶WWW的域名轉向到帶WWW域名,vhosts.conf中配置為:
<VirtualHost *:80>
ServerName www.*****.cn
DocumentRoot /home/lesishu
</VirtualHost>
<VirtualHost *:80>
ServerName lesishu.cn
RedirectMatch permanent ^/(.*) http://www.*****.cn/$1
</VirtualHost>
Apache下除了以上2種方法,還有其他配置方法和可選參數(shù),建議閱讀Apache文檔。
301轉向情況檢測
http://www.seoconsultants.com/tools/headers.asp
http://www.internetofficer.com/seo-tool/redirect-check/
三、by自動跳轉的域名
是新的域名。
域名跳轉就是當你訪問老域名時會自動跳轉到新域名上面,因為你的老客戶可能不知道你換域名了,他還會訪問你的老域名,這樣的話若不做跳轉他就訪問不到,他就會認為你的網(wǎng)站出毛病了,很可能失去一個老客戶,所以我們在用新域名的同時,老域名也不要丟掉。
域名,又稱網(wǎng)域,是由一串用點分隔的名字組成的Internet上某一臺計算機或計算機組的名稱。
四、網(wǎng)站被掛馬了輸入域名自動跳轉怎么辦
1、刪除所有內容,數(shù)據(jù)庫。
2、然后用備份的內容和數(shù)據(jù)庫恢復。
3、檢查服務器日志,找出問題所在,修補漏洞。
以上就是關于老域名失效自動跳轉相關問題的回答。希望能幫到你,如有更多相關問題,您也可以聯(lián)系我們的客服進行咨詢,客服也會為您講解更多精彩的知識和內容。
推薦閱讀:
網(wǎng)站老域名跳轉到新域名(請使用域名訪問網(wǎng)站)
產業(yè)規(guī)劃方案(產業(yè)園規(guī)劃方案)